Transfer of Heat By Conduction and Radiation Between Systems

Heat can flow into or out of a closed system by way of thermal conduction or of thermal radiation to or from a thermal reservoir, and when this process is effecting net transfer of heat, the system's temperature can be changing, and if so, the system is not in thermal equilibrium.
